How they compare
Guatemala currently reports 34,632 against 34,533 in Spain, a difference of 99.
The two have swapped places 1 time across 16 shared years of data; in 1980 it was Spain ahead.
Guatemala ranks 26th and Spain ranks 27th of 199 countries.
Spain has averaged higher in every one of the 4 decades both report.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Guatemala | Spain |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1980s | 1,073 | 81,204 | 80,131 | Spain |
| 2000s | 4,849 | 68,802 | 63,953 | Spain |
| 2010s | 11,516 | 51,784 | 40,269 | Spain |
| 2020s | 15,357 | 37,244 | 21,888 | Spain |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
